In 1957, John T. Dillard moved to Leland, Mississippi, with his family and began cotton farming operations on Greenland Plantation at McGrath, MS.  Today, Greenland Planting Company continues this family farming legacy, growing rice, soybeans, and corn on the Dillard family lands in Washington and Sunflower counties.
